    Abstract: A pre-winding type photographic camera is provided with a mode changing mechanism for changing its operational mode between a pre-winding mode in which film is drawn out from a film magazine loaded in the camera and is taken up around the spool of the camera prior to photographing, and photographing mode in which the film is rewound into the film magazine by one frame each time the film is exposed.

    Abstract: A joint structure of a metallic tubular member and metallic annular parts, the annular parts being joined to the outer periphery of the tubular member as in a camshaft. Each of the annular parts has around its inner periphery at least one serrated portion which cuts into the outer periphery of the tubular member when they are joined, the annular part also having a planar portion facing another portion of the tubular member in such a manner that substantially no pressure is exerted on the planar portion of the annular part.A method of making such structure involves positioning of the tubular member is required in relation to the annular parts, as by use of a split die, and then forcing into the tubular member a pressing member to expand the tubular member so that the serrated portions cut into the outer periphery of the tubular member.

    Abstract: In a corrosion-resistant, double-wall pipe structure formed by tightly fitting a stainless-steel inner pipe in an outer pipe, the inner pipe at any portion thereof which is liable to be adversely affected by heat due to heat processing is replaced by an inner tube of a special metal having corrosion resistance which is not easily impaired by the heat, the inner tube being joined integrally to the remainder portion of the inner pipe of the stainless steel. Examples of the special metal are Inconel 625, Incoloy 825, and Hastelloy.

    Abstract: In a clothes dryer, the electrical resistance of wet articles and the temperature of exhaust air are monitored. At the instant the monitored electrical resistance reaches a predetermined value, the time-varying rate of change of the monitored temperature is detected, to estimate the period of time for which the dryer operation is to be continued. At the end of the estimated time period, the heat cycle of the dryer is shut down.

    Abstract: A gas sensor is described which includes a layer of a sensitive material formed on an electric insulating substrate and spaced electrodes electrically connected to the layer. The layer is formed of a porous film of a uniform mixture which contains a p-type compound oxide semiconductor with a perovskite type of crystal structure as the major ingredient and one or more of vanadium, niobium, tantalum and/or compounds thereof as minor ingredients. The minor ingredients are contained in the layer in an amount of 0.01 to 5% by weight, based on the weight of the p-type compound oxide semiconductor, and are incorporated into the layer by diffusing them into the layer. The gas sensor exhibits a small change with time and a reduced tailing effect attendant on variations in the gas combustion. With this, it is possible to effect measurements, detection and control with a high reliability.

    Abstract: Tensile residual stress in an annular welded joint part joining the ends of unit pipes is mechanically removed by applying repeated hammering strokes against the inner surface of the pipes over the entire joint part, thereby to cause such part to undergo local plastic deformation. The repeated hammering strokes, which have a peening effect, are applied by several automatically operating hammering devices mounted radially on a rotary head secured to and unitarily moving with a shaft which is driveable in rotation about its axis and in translation in its axial direction.

    Abstract: A double-wall composite pipe is produced by inserting an inner pipe in an outer pipe, filling the inner pipe with cold water under pressure to cause the inner pipe to expand plastically into tight contact with the outer pipe, applying heat to the outer part of the outer pipe by high-frequency induction heating, thereby to establish a locally heated zone thereof around the circumference thereof and causing the heated zone to travel from one end to the other end of the outer pipe thereby to cause it to successively expand locally in diameter in the travelling heated zone. The pressure in the inner pipe then is removed, the pipes thereafter being permitted to attain the ambient temperature, thereby to obtain an interference fit therebetween.

    Abstract: An automatic rewinding camera wherein an automatic advance of the photographic film by one frame is caused by shutter release operation and rewinding of the photographic film is automatically started when the film is prevented from further advance. The camera has a film-driven sprocket wheel, by the rotation of which film movement signals are produced. A timer circuit maintains, during the passage of a predetermined active time which is shorter than the time required to advance the photographic film by one frame, the camera motor in forward rotation so as to advance the photographic film. The timer circuit is reset by the film movement signals. But when those film signals stop, that is, when the film is fully extended from the cartridge, then the timer is not reset; and the measurement of the full predetermined active time, by the timer, without resetting, results in the motor being reversed to rewind the film.

    Abstract: The inner surface of a hollow article of special shape such as a pipe elbow or bellows is lined with a tightly fitted protective lining material by the steps of emplacing the lining material within the hollow article to confront the inner surface thereof, causing the temperature of the hollow article to be higher than that of the lining material, applying an expanding force to the lining material thereby to cause it to undergo plastic expansion together with the hollow article, removing the expanding force, and causing the temperature of the hollow structure to become lower than that of the lining material thereby to produce a tight fit therebetween due to interference.

    Abstract: An inner stainless-steel tube having an outer frustoconical faying surface is fitted into an outer carbon-steel tube having a matching inner frustoconical faying surface, and these tubes are friction welded over their entire faying surfaces by pressing the tubes together in their axial direction to obtain a high contact pressure due to a wedge action and, at the same time, imparting rotation thereto relative to each other thereby to obtain an integrally bonded, laminated, tubular blank, which is then extended by a suitable process such as rolling into a clad steel tube. The tubular blank can also be slit in its axial direction and flattened into a laminated flat blank, which can be rolled into a clad steel plate. The inner tube may be replaced by a solid core metal. In this case, an integrally bonded blank made up of the inner core metal and the outer tube is extended into a clad steel tube or into a clad steel shape.

    Abstract: An outer pipe is diametrically expanded by heating and an inner pipe is diametrically contracted by cooling with a coolant introduced into the inner pipe to produce between the pipes a clearance just sufficient for insertion of the inner pipe into the outer pipe, and then the coolant is pressurized to expand the inner pipe against and together with the outer pipe, the pressure being removed after the pipes have expanded to a specific diameter of the joint therebetween. The tightness of the fit between the pipes due to the expansion is further increased by the subsequent thermal shrinkage of the outer pipe and thermal expansion of the inner pipe.

    Abstract: A steel blank is placed in intimate contact along a joint interface with a blank of another metal, and the two blanks are welded along and throughout the interface by a superhigh-output electron beam thereby to obtain a metallurgical welded joint and to form an integral blank which is rolled or otherwise formed into a clad steel article.

    Abstract: A flux composition for ceramic color, containing no harmful heavy metal such as lead, cadmium, chromium, etc. is provided.The flux composition consists mainly of 30 to 45% of SiO.sub.2, 0 to 5% of TiO.sub.2, 4 to 10% of ZrO.sub.2, 13 to 18% of B.sub.2 O.sub.3, 18 to 23% of ZnO, 0 to 3% of CaO, 12 to 15% of the total of two or three kinds of R.sub.2 O selected from Na.sub.2 O, K.sub.2 O and Li.sub.2 O, 4 to 10% of fluorine and 0 to 5% of tin oxide (% being all by weight).The composition uses no lead which has been indispensable for lower melting glasses, and exhibits superior performances difficult to afford according to conventional lower melting lead-free fluxes.
